ísí

isi

Wordisi
Definitions

Noun

1.head

2.source

3.head (as in hierarchy)

4.chapter

5.hairstyle

6.essence; meaning

7.chapter [of a book/Bible]

chí

chi

Wordchi
Definitions

Noun

1.guardian angel; god; God

2.life source; soul; essence

3.fate

4.day
